Easy Taco Seasoning Mix
Ingredients
- 1 tsp onion powder
- 3 tsp ground cumin
- 2 tsp chili powder
- ½ tsp cayenne red pepper
- ½ tsp garlic powder
Instructions
- Stir to thoroughly combine these spices together. You can increase the amount and make enough in bulk for future uses.
- Set final seasoning aside for cooking with OR put inside a spice jar for future usage.

About This Easy Taco Seasoning Recipe From Scratch
It takes just a few nearly common spices to make this easy recipe. You might already have the onion power, red cayenne pepper, and garlic powder. The key spices remaining are cumin and chili powder that give it that unique flavor. And, you can save a lot of money making your own.
